This is a varied role where you will take ownership of electrical design projects from concept through to commissioning, working closely with manufacturing, installation and engineering teams to deliver high quality solutions for customers.

The Senior Electrical Design Engineer will have the opportunity to mentor junior engineers, contribute to new product development and play a key role in driving continuous improvement across the engineering department.

 

Responsibilities of the Senior Electrical Design Engineer

  • Design electrical control systems for bespoke projects
  • Produce and maintain electrical schematics and technical documentation using CAD software
  • Select and specify electrical components, cabling and control equipment
  • Configure and support PLCs and variable frequency drives (VFDs)
  • Provide technical support during equipment build, testing, commissioning and fault finding
  • Assist with prototype development, testing and design validation
  • Support and mentor junior engineers within the team
  • Work collaboratively with production, installation and project teams to ensure successful project delivery
  • Identify opportunities to improve engineering processes, product quality and efficiency
  • Ensure designs comply with relevant electrical standards and company quality procedures

 

Requirements of the Senior Electrical Design Engineer

  • Degree, HNC or equivalent qualification in Electrical Engineering
  • At least 5 years' experience within an Electrical Design role
  • Experience designing electrical control panels
  • Strong knowledge of PLCs and variable frequency drives
  • Experience producing electrical schematics using Electrical CAD software
  • Ability to interpret and apply electrical standards and best practices
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to work across multiple departments
  • Able to manage multiple projects in a fast-paced engineering environment
  • Experience within material handling or a similar engineering environment (desired)
